A typical proposed amendment to the Constitution is given how many years to be ratified by the states.

Answers

Although there has been no determination as to how long a ratification process may take, the Supreme Court of the United States has said that ratification must be within "some reasonable time after the proposal".

Ever since the 18th amendment, Congress has traditionally set that period at seven years. Therefore, a typical proposed amendment to the Constitution is given seven years to be ratified by the states.

On the 18th amendment, the Supreme court stated that  states must ratify a proposed amendment 'within reasonable time', but the time never been specifically defined

For the 18th, 20th, 21st , and the 22nd amendments, The congress set the ratification processing period at 7 years

Sanctions can be positive or negative. True False

Answers

True, Sanctions, as defined within sociology, are ways of enforcing compliance with social norms. Sanctions are positive when they are used to celebrate conformity and negative when they are used to punish or discourage nonconformity.
